New Jersey 2026-2027 Regular Session

New Jersey Senate Bill S3743

Introduced
3/5/26  

Caption

Makes supplemental appropriation of $4.8 million to provide additional operational aid to Jefferson Township Public Schools.

Summary

Senate Bill 3743 makes a supplemental appropriation of $4,796,000 from the General Fund for the fiscal year ending June 30, 2026. The money is directed to the Department of Education as state aid for Jefferson Township Public Schools, specifically for operational aid. The bill is presented as a supplement to the existing FY2026 appropriations act and would take effect immediately upon enactment. According to the statement, the additional funding is intended to help close a funding gap experienced by the district. In practical terms, the bill would increase state support for one local school district outside the normal annual aid allocation, providing a targeted infusion of operating funds rather than a broad change to school funding formulas.

Impact

The bill would amend the FY2026 appropriations law by adding a specific $4.796 million line item under the Department of Education for Jefferson Township Public Schools. It does not create a new program or change statewide education policy; instead, it authorizes a one-time supplemental state aid payment from the General Fund to a named district. The affected party is Jefferson Township Public Schools, which would receive additional operational support if the bill is enacted.
